What is the r.m.s. value of an alternating current which when passed through a resistor produces heat which is thrice of that produced by a direct current of `2` amperes in the same resistor?

A

`6` ampere

B

`2` ampere

C

`2sqrt3` ampere

D

`0.65` ampere

Text Solution

Verified by Experts

The correct Answer is:
C
